The Opportunity: We are seeking a self-motivated, dedicated, and experienced Assistant Store Manager to lead a team of retail employees within a large format retail store in Horsham VIC. About You: Your success factors will be your ability to: Lead a team in a high volume fast-moving setting or General Merchandise, however this is not a necessity. Have flexibility and commitment to work in a 7-day store. Your Responsibilities: An Assistant Store Manager has four key areas of responsibility: People, Product, Processes and Store: People: Have a passion for coaching, developing and empowering teams of 20+ through constructive and positive performance management with and a hands-on approach. Have strong communication, motivational and leadership skills that display an eagerness to make a difference. Product: Have a flair for merchandising. Have a strong passion and focus on driving high volumes of stock. Processes: Reporting to the Store Manager, you will be responsible for the store’s financial performance (sales, controllable costs etc.), customer service standards, store standards and inventory management. Store: Actively maintain store standards through leading by example. Have a strong focus on promoting and leading health and safety in store.
